    Discovering the Best BBQ at Wiley's Championship BBQ: A Must-Visit in Savannah

    If you find yourself in Savannah, missing out on Wiley's Championship BBQ should be a crime! This place serves up the best American BBQ I've ever had, hands down. The sampler platter was a carnivore's dream come true, featuring brisket, ribs, chicken, and pork paired with an array of sides like potato salad, beans, broccoli rice, and Brunswick stew. Each bite was a burst of flavor, especially the ribs and brisket which were cooked to perfection—fall off the bone ribs and brisket that was just the right amount of dry yet moist enough to keep you coming back for more. And oh, the sauces! They are simply out of this world and deserve a special mention.

    The atmosphere at Wiley's is unassuming yet welcoming, with a clean and well-maintained setting that includes some cozy outdoor seating. The service is stellar, making you feel right at home. Even the sides stand out on their own; the broccoli cheese and rice casserole was particularly outstanding, and they weren't kidding when they said they have the best beans on the planet! For dessert, the banana pudding and peach cobbler were the perfect end to a delightful meal. Trust me, the photos I took can't even begin to do justice to the deliciousness of the food here. Wiley's Championship BBQ is a true champion of flavors and you'd be missing out if you didn't stop by!

    Address: 4700 US-80, Savannah, GA 31410
    Phone: (912) 201-3259
